起步软件技术论坛
搜索
 找回密码
 注册

QQ登录

只需一步,快速开始

查看: 3526|回复: 18

[结贴] 根据FID获得 从从数据。

[复制链接]

15

主题

650

帖子

1723

积分

金牌会员

Rank: 6Rank: 6

积分
1723
QQ
发表于 2014-9-3 11:27:31 | 显示全部楼层 |阅读模式
大家好,我现在有这么一个问题,我有张单子,牵扯到四张表,关系分别是 主 - 从-从-从。例如:主单子(1) - 收货人(n) -货物信息(n) - 货物详细(n),也就是 一对多,多对多,多对多,多对多关系。现在我想根据 主单子编号,获得对应的 从-从-从表信息。使用loadJson(),可以获得 主-从信息,那么 从-从-从表信息不好获得,因为它们之间要关联,关联的fid 都是新产生的,那么怎么将所有关联数据获得并展示呢,从表都是用grid 来展示,请赐教,不慎感激。

91

主题

13万

帖子

3万

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
36185
发表于 2014-9-3 11:56:07 | 显示全部楼层
收货人(n) -货物信息(n)之间是多对多的关系?
远程的联系方法QQ1392416607,添加好友时,需在备注里注明其论坛名字及ID,公司等信息
发远程时同时也发一下帖子地址,方便了解要解决的问题  WeX5教程  WeX5下载



如按照该方法解决,请及时跟帖,便于版主结贴
回复 支持 反对

使用道具 举报

15

主题

650

帖子

1723

积分

金牌会员

Rank: 6Rank: 6

积分
1723
QQ
 楼主| 发表于 2014-9-3 12:55:54 | 显示全部楼层
jishuang 发表于 2014-9-3 11:56
收货人(n) -货物信息(n)之间是多对多的关系?

对。
回复 支持 反对

使用道具 举报

45

主题

4492

帖子

3960

积分

论坛元老

Rank: 8Rank: 8

积分
3960
QQ
发表于 2014-9-3 12:59:55 | 显示全部楼层
你是想查看 主单子,下面所有的 货物详细 信息吗。

你可以用KSQL或者 SQL 语句, 用 IN 查询即可查询出货物的详细信息。
需要 三个 in   ,如果想一步到位的话,数据量大了会有效率问题。
向前进,向前进,我们……
回复 支持 反对

使用道具 举报

15

主题

650

帖子

1723

积分

金牌会员

Rank: 6Rank: 6

积分
1723
QQ
 楼主| 发表于 2014-9-3 13:52:31 | 显示全部楼层
fpj 发表于 2014-9-3 12:59
你是想查看 主单子,下面所有的 货物详细 信息吗。

你可以用KSQL或者 SQL 语句, 用 IN 查询即可查询出货 ...

拿数据没的问题,主要是将数据绑定到bizData上,怎么给新数据建立关系,且绑定到对应的bizData上。
回复 支持 反对

使用道具 举报

45

主题

4492

帖子

3960

积分

论坛元老

Rank: 8Rank: 8

积分
3960
QQ
发表于 2014-9-3 13:58:23 | 显示全部楼层
zf_fz 发表于 2014-9-3 13:52
拿数据没的问题,主要是将数据绑定到bizData上,怎么给新数据建立关系,且绑定到对应的bizData上。 ...

用ACTION中的KSQL或者 SQL 查询出你要的数据后,返回TABLE,再LOAD到bizdata中,
然后用GRID关联 bizdata,对数据进行展示。

评分

参与人数 1 +3 收起 理由
jishuang + 3 赞一个!

查看全部评分

向前进,向前进,我们……
回复 支持 反对

使用道具 举报

15

主题

650

帖子

1723

积分

金牌会员

Rank: 6Rank: 6

积分
1723
QQ
 楼主| 发表于 2014-9-3 14:06:08 | 显示全部楼层
fpj 发表于 2014-9-3 13:58
用ACTION中的KSQL或者 SQL 查询出你要的数据后,返回TABLE,再LOAD到bizdata中,
然后用GRID关联 b ...

你的意思是将多张表的数据查询出来返回返回一个Table吗,这样怎么跟界面上的bizData关联呢?
回复 支持 反对

使用道具 举报

91

主题

13万

帖子

3万

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
36185
发表于 2014-9-3 14:49:43 | 显示全部楼层
远程的联系方法QQ1392416607,添加好友时,需在备注里注明其论坛名字及ID,公司等信息
发远程时同时也发一下帖子地址,方便了解要解决的问题  WeX5教程  WeX5下载



如按照该方法解决,请及时跟帖,便于版主结贴
回复 支持 反对

使用道具 举报

15

主题

650

帖子

1723

积分

金牌会员

Rank: 6Rank: 6

积分
1723
QQ
 楼主| 发表于 2014-9-4 20:35:27 | 显示全部楼层
如果使用试图获得数据返回一个Table 那么怎么将这个返回的Table 绑定到不同的BizData 上面(个个bizData存在主从关系),这个问题不知道怎么解决。
回复 支持 反对

使用道具 举报

45

主题

4492

帖子

3960

积分

论坛元老

Rank: 8Rank: 8

积分
3960
QQ
发表于 2014-9-4 21:23:25 | 显示全部楼层
zf_fz 发表于 2014-9-4 20:35
如果使用试图获得数据返回一个Table 那么怎么将这个返回的Table 绑定到不同的BizData 上面(个个bizData存 ...

上面跟你说过,将ACTION中查询得到的table数据,直接load到bizdata组件中,然后通过 grid 进行展示即可。
你不知道你那里不明白。
向前进,向前进,我们……
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|X3技术论坛|Justep Inc.    

GMT+8, 2025-7-6 13:20 , Processed in 0.051827 second(s), 24 queries .

Powered by Discuz! X3.4

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表